A stainless steel patio heater is a square pyramid. The length of one side of the base is 22.4 in. The slant height of the pyram

id is 93.7 in. What is the height of the​ pyramid?
Mathematics
1 answer:
mrs_skeptik [129]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

93.03 in

Step-by-step explanation:

Height of square pyramid: √slant height² - (1/2 base side length)²

SH = √93.7² - 11.2² = 93.03
